Media Training for Judicial Spokespersons
Effective media training is vital for judicial spokespeople to communicate complex legal concepts clearly and confidently. This training enhances their ability to deliver messages accurately, maintain credibility, and manage media inquiries effectively.
The process involves developing skills in message framing, controlling dialogue, and handling sensitive questions. Judicial spokespersons learn to avoid legal jargon that may confuse the public and instead focus on transparent, sincere communication.
Additionally, media training emphasizes crisis communication techniques. Spokespersons are prepared to respond swiftly and appropriately during legal controversies or crises, preserving the judiciary’s reputation. Proper training also covers non-verbal cues and interview etiquette, ensuring a professional appearance.
Thorough media training ultimately helps judicial entities foster trust and understanding within the community. By equipping spokespersons with these skills, the judiciary can uphold transparency and accountability in an increasingly complex media environment.
Developing Internal Communication Protocols
Developing internal communication protocols is a foundational element of effective judicial public relations strategies within judicial administration. Clear protocols ensure that information flows efficiently and accurately among court officials, staff, and external stakeholders.
A well-structured communication framework typically includes guidelines for message consistency, designated spokespersons, and approval processes to prevent misinformation. It also establishes channels for internal updates, feedback, and crisis response, safeguarding the judiciary’s integrity.
Implementing these protocols involves key steps such as:
- Defining roles and responsibilities for communication
- Creating standardized messaging templates
- Training personnel on communication procedures
- Regularly reviewing and updating protocols to adapt to changes in the legal environment.
Legal and Ethical Considerations in Judicial Public Relations Strategies
Legal and ethical considerations are fundamental in designing effective judicial public relations strategies. Upholding transparency, impartiality, and integrity ensures public trust remains intact. Judicial entities must adhere strictly to laws governing communication to prevent misinformation or bias.
Maintaining confidentiality and respecting privacy rights are also paramount. While transparency fosters openness, it must not compromise sensitive legal proceedings or individual rights. Clear boundaries are essential to balance openness with confidentiality obligations.
Ethical conduct entails avoiding political influence, favoritism, or any appearance of impropriety. Judicial public relations strategies should emphasize neutrality, impartiality, and adherence to professional standards. These principles preserve the judiciary’s independence and credibility in the public eye.
